Paper : Post-colonial narratives
Overview
PAPER: post-colonial narratives was a 2021 exhibition curated by Klaudia Ofwona Draber for the North American Hand Papermakers in collaboration with Dieu Donné. The exhibit grapples with the repercussions and legacy of colonial power structures through the medium of paper. The PAPER: post-colonial narratives catalogue features nine artists, forty years of papermaking (1981-2021), and six thought-provoking essays.
